Specialty Analyst/Developer Job Summary:
The main function of a specialty analyst/developer is to develop, create, and modify general computer applications software or specialized utility programs utilizing software packages considered. A typical specialty analyst/developer is responsible for designing software or customizing software for client use with the aim of optimizing operational efficiency.

What you’ll do as a Specialty Analyst/Developer:
  • Modify existing software to correct errors, allow it to adapt to new hardware, or to improve its performance.
  • Analyze user needs and software requirements to determine feasibility of design within time and cost constraints.
  • Coordinate software system installation and monitor equipment functioning to ensure specifications are met.
  • Design, develop and modify software systems, using scientific analysis and mathematical models to predict and measure outcome and consequences of design.
  • Analyze information to determine, recommend, and plan computer specifications and layouts, and peripheral equipment modifications.
  • Obtain and evaluate information on factors such as reporting formats required, costs, and security needs to determine hardware configuration.
  • Consult with customers about software system design and maintenance.
  • Confer with systems analysts, engineers, programmers and others to design system and to obtain information on project limitations and capabilities, performance requirements and interfaces.

 

What you’ll bring to the Specialty Analyst/Developer role:
  • Bachelor's degree in computer science or equivalent training required.
  • 5-7 years related experience required.Excellent verbal and written communication skills, problem solving skills, customer service and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work independently and manage one’s time.
  • Basic mentoring skills necessary to provide support and constructive performance feedback.
  • Knowledge of circuit boards, processors, electronic equipment and computer hardware and software.
  • Knowledge of design techniques and principles involved in production of drawings and models.
  • Knowledge of niche computer software, such as Oracle, Csharp.net, Lawson, etc.
